How to connect Render and Zoho Cliq

Create a New Scenario to Connect Render and Zoho Cliq

In the workspace, click the β€œCreate New Scenario” button.

Add the First Step

Add the first node – a trigger that will initiate the scenario when it receives the required event. Triggers can be scheduled, called by a Render, triggered by another scenario, or executed manually (for testing purposes). In most cases, Render or Zoho Cliq will be your first step. To do this, click "Choose an app," find Render or Zoho Cliq, and select the appropriate trigger to start the scenario.

Save and Activate the Scenario

After configuring Render, Zoho Cliq, and any additional nodes, don’t forget to save the scenario and click "Deploy." Activating the scenario ensures it will run automatically whenever the trigger node receives input or a condition is met. By default, all newly created scenarios are deactivated.

Test the Scenario

Run the scenario by clicking β€œRun once” and triggering an event to check if the Render and Zoho Cliq integration works as expected. Depending on your setup, data should flow between Render and Zoho Cliq (or vice versa). Easily troubleshoot the scenario by reviewing the execution history to identify and fix any issues.

Most powerful ways to connect Render and Zoho Cliq

Github + Render + Zoho Cliq: When a new release is published on Github, trigger a deploy on Render, and then send a notification to a Zoho Cliq channel to inform the team.

UptimeRobot + Render + Zoho Cliq: When UptimeRobot detects that a Render service is down, send a notification to a Zoho Cliq channel to alert the team of the downtime.

Are there any limitations to the Render and Zoho Cliq integration on Latenode?

While the integration is powerful, there are certain limitations to be aware of:

  • Rate limits imposed by Render and Zoho Cliq APIs may affect workflow execution.
  • Complex data transformations might require JavaScript coding within Latenode.
  • Initial setup requires understanding of both Render and Zoho Cliq APIs.
